686DLX 1.6. What is AGP The Accelerated Graphics Port (AGP) is a new port on the Host-To-PCI bridge device that supports an AGP port. The main purpose of the AGP port is to provide fast access to system memory. The AGP port can be used either as fast PCI port (32-bits at 66MHz vs. 32- bits at 33MHz) or as an AGP port which supports 2x data-rate, a read queue, and side band addressing.

686DLX inserted into socket completely. 3.5. CPU SPEED SETUP The system's speed is fixed to 66.6MHz. The user can change the DIP SWITCH (S1) selection to set up the CPU speed for 200 - 633MHz processor. The CPU speed must match with the frequency RATIO. It will cause system hanging up if the frequency RATIO is higher than CPU's.

SPEAKER CONNECTOR INSTALLATION There is always a speaker in AT system for sound purpose. The 4 - Pins connector J5 is used to connect speaker. The speaker can work well in both direction of connector when it is installed to the connector J5 on mainboard.
